What is happening in Zephaniah 3?
Zephaniah 3 belongs to the closing movement of the book, especially the section often described as purification and joy in Zion. Zephaniah combines severe day-of-the-Lord judgment with a tender closing vision of God rejoicing over a purified people. Read this chapter with the wider themes of day of the Lord, judgment, and humility in view so the individual verses keep their proper weight.
